What air quality testing can and cannot tell you
Solid testing answers three practical questions. First, is there a significant pollutant burden indoors, compared with outdoors or a nearby control area. Second, what type of contaminants are present, like mold spores, bacteria, VOCs from paint or cleaners, or fine particulates from cooking and candles. Third, how those findings point toward likely sources, such as water intrusion, a dirty evaporator coil, or saturated carpet padding. Good testing does not instantly diagnose every issue. It does not swap for common sense inspections, nor does a single sample tell the whole story. The building blocks of reputable testing
A professional approach blends three elements. Start with a moisture and visual assessment. Meter walls, ceilings, and baseboards. Scan with infrared to spot thermal anomalies that suggest hidden moisture. Inspect the air handler, the coil, and the return plenum. Check for microbial growth on insulation, rust patterns, dirty blower housings, and bypass gaps that pull attic air into returns. Then, add air and surface sampling where findings justify it. Finally, match results to outdoor baselines and building history, then outline next steps.
For air, indoor mold testing Tampa providers often run spore trap cassettes calibrated to 15 liters per minute for 5 to 10 minutes, collecting a defined volume of air. This pattern gives a usable snapshot without overloading slides. Surface sampling, if discoloration is present, can include tape lifts and swabs. If odors or occupant symptoms suggest chemical sources, a VOC screen or formaldehyde badge can add clarity. When black mold testing Tampa searches target Stachybotrys and Chaetomium specifically, the conversation turns quickly to water events because those species thrive on chronic moisture and cellulose.
A word on scope: more samples are not always better. In a 1,600 square foot South Tampa bungalow with one suspect bathroom and a musty HVAC closet, three interior spore traps, one outdoor control, and two surface samples may answer the mail. In a 10,000 square foot office with complaints across zones, the grid grows because airflow dynamics vary. Choose the count that matches risk and complexity, not a fixed package.
Interpreting lab results without spinning your wheels
Raw counts and species lists can confuse. A seasoned local mold specialist Tampa residents recommend will translate the report. Tampa’s outdoor air typically carries Cladosporium, Basidiospores, and light Ascospores in warm months. Indoor results should reflect equal or lower totals compared to outdoor controls, and problem species inside should not exceed outside without a plausible source. If indoor Aspergillus/Penicillium spikes higher than outdoors in several rooms, start hunting for damp drywall, a wet subfloor under tile, or compromised duct liners. If Stachybotrys appears inside but not outside, do not ignore it, that usually signals a materials issue like a wet baseplate, a shower curb leak, or a roof-to-wall transition failure.
A single low Stachybotrys count on an air sample does not always mean a current airborne hazard. Stachy spores tend to be sticky and settle quickly, and air sampling may only detect them during disturbance. Surface sampling on suspect material is often the clearer tool. The HVAC factor: the quiet driver of indoor conditions
Many Tampa homes run their AC ten months a year. An oversized unit can cool air quickly without removing enough moisture, leaving relative humidity creeping above 60 percent. That is spore-friendly territory. Short cycling and high supply temperatures also let coils stay wet longer, feeding biofilm. Duct leakage pulls attic or garage air into the return path, raising particulate counts and odors. A mold consultation Tampa with a contractor who understands Manual J load calcs, duct design, and latent capacity pays for itself over time.
Filters matter. A MERV 8 pleated filter is a bare minimum. If you have allergy concerns and a tight duct system, a MERV 11 or 13 can capture more fine particulates, though you must confirm the blower can handle the pressure drop. UV lights on coils can limit growth but do not fix humidity or dirt. Cleaning the coil and pan, sealing return leaks, and managing runtime with a thermostat that supports dehumidification give better returns.

Edge cases and judgment calls
Not every musty odor equals active mold. Old books, carpeting, and unfinished wood can hold smells even after moisture is corrected. Here, environmental mold testing Tampa can confirm whether airborne counts are normal, letting you focus on deep cleaning and material replacement for odor, rather than chasing hidden leaks that no longer exist. Conversely, a space can smell fine yet harbor a problem behind clean paint. I have cut into baseboards after reading high wall moisture near a flooded patio door, only to find clean studs and a single darkened plate. We replaced the plate, dried the cavity, and sealed the threshold, and post remediation verification passed on the first round.
Black staining on AC ducts is often condensation dust, not mold. Tape lift testing resolves it quickly. Aftercare: keeping clean air, not just achieving it once
Testing and remediation fix the snapshot. Long term air quality depends on habits and maintenance. Keep indoor humidity between 45 and 55 percent. Run bath fans long enough to clear steam. Service the AC twice per year, and change filters on schedule. Watch for small leaks under sinks and at refrigerator supply lines. If you sublet or use a property seasonally, set the thermostat to manage humidity, not just temperature. A data logger that records temperature and RH costs little and tells you if a summer week ran humid enough to risk condensation.
